球形端面车牙的编程方法如下:
确定加工参数
螺纹类型(外螺纹、内螺纹等)。
螺距(螺纹的间距)。
进给速度(切削速度)。
螺纹的终点坐标(X_和Z_)。
螺纹的总进给量(P_)。
螺纹的进给单位(Q_)。
螺纹的切削深度(R_)。
螺纹的切削宽度(I_)。
螺纹的切削角度(K_)。
设置初始位置
使用G92指令设置坐标系原点,并将其设置为当前位置。例如:`G92 X0 Z0` 将当前位置设置为螺纹起点。
设置进给速度
使用G96指令设置恒定切削速度。例如:`G96 F100` 设置进给速度为100(单位通常为mm/min)。
移动车刀到起点
使用G00指令或G01指令将车刀移动到螺纹加工的起点位置。例如:`G00 X10 Z0` 或 `G01 X10 Z0`。
开始螺纹加工
使用G76指令开始螺纹加工,指定螺纹的终点坐标、进给量、进给单位等参数。例如:`G76 X20 Z10 P5 Q0.5 R2 I1 K45`。
结束程序
完成螺纹加工后,使用M30指令结束程序。
示例程序
```plaintext
G92 X0 Z0 ; 设置坐标系原点为当前位置
G96 F100 ; 设置进给速度为100 mm/min
G00 X10 Z0; 将车刀移动到螺纹加工的起点位置
G76 X20 Z10 P5 Q0.5 R2 I1 K45 ; 开始螺纹加工
M30 ; 结束程序
```
注意事项
螺纹加工的具体参数需要根据实际情况进行设置,如切削速度、进给速度等。
需要根据车床的型号和控制系统的要求,调整和编写相应的参数和指令。
通过以上步骤,你可以使用G76指令在数控车床上编程实现球形端面车牙的加工。